Bodybuilding is a sport that emphasizes the development of muscle mass and strength, and one of the key players in this process is the growth hormone. Growth hormones are natural substances produced by the pituitary gland that stimulate growth, cell reproduction, and regeneration in humans. When it comes to bodybuilding, these hormones play a critical role in enhancing muscle development and recovery.

How Growth Hormones Work
Growth hormones influence several physiological processes that are beneficial for bodybuilders, including:
- Increased protein synthesis: This leads to muscle growth and recovery after intense workouts.
- Enhanced fat metabolism: Growth hormones help in reducing body fat by promoting lipolysis.
- Improved recovery: These hormones assist in repairing tissues and reducing muscle soreness.

Risks and Considerations
While the potential benefits of growth hormones are significant, it’s important to consider the risks involved. Possible side effects include:
- Joint pain: Excessive levels can lead to discomfort in joints.
- Increased risk of diabetes: Growth hormones can affect insulin sensitivity.
- Cardiac issues: Prolonged use can lead to heart-related problems.
